Text: | Now the shades of night are gone |
Author: | Samson Occum |
Tune: | WESLEY |
Composer: | Thomas Hastings |
1 Now the shades of night are gone,
Now the morning light is come:
Lord, we would be Thine today,
Drive the shades of sin away.
Fill our souls with heav'nly light,
Banish doubt and cleanse our sight;
In Thy service, Lord, today
Help us labor, help us pray.
2 Keep our haughty passions bound;
Save us from our foes around;
Going out and coming in,
Keep us safe from ev'ry sin.
When our work of life is past
Oh, receive us all at last!
Night of sin will be no more,
When we reach the heavenly shore.
Amen.
